Aortic Valve Replacement With Donor Valve

New Hampshire rates for HCPCS 33406

Open-heart surgery that removes a damaged aortic valve and replaces it with a valve taken from a human donor. The heart is stopped and a heart-lung machine takes over circulation while the new valve is sewn into place. A donor valve avoids the need for lifelong blood thinning medicine that a mechanical valve requires.

How much does Aortic Valve Replacement With Donor Valve cost?

$15,842

Typical total for the visit. In New Hampshire,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$15,842 for this procedure. That total is two separate charges: $5,370 to the doctor who performs it, and $10,471 to the hospital or surgery center where it takes place. Done somewhere without a facility charge, you pay only the first.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 5 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
